Amanda McAdams, a 10th-grade English teacher at Apollo High School in Glendale, was named the 2011 Teacher of the Year by the Arizona Educational Foundation on Thursday.
"I'm thrilled and I'm very excited," she said. "I hope to let all Arizonans know that teachers hold our future there, and we need to get legislators who support education."McAdams becomes spokeswoman for the foundation and receives $20,000 cash, $17,000 worth of classroom technology and other prizes.
Finalists were Pam Barrier, Boulder Creek High, Anthem; Brandi Dignum, Richardson Elementary, Tucson; Josh Tabor, Canyon Del Oro High, Oro Valley; and Andy Townsend, Elvira Elementary, Tucson.
